Seychelles vs Panama: Budget-Friendly Offshore Company Formation Comparison

Seychelles and Panama consistently rank among the most cost-effective offshore company formation jurisdictions. Both offer legitimate offshore structures, strong privacy protections, and efficient processing times at significantly lower costs than premium jurisdictions like BVI or Cayman Islands.

This comparison analyzes formation costs, annual fees, banking access, processing speed, and overall value to determine which budget-friendly jurisdiction best suits your offshore company needs.

Banking Access Comparison

Seychelles Banking Relationships

  • Limited local banking infrastructure
  • Moderate international bank acceptance (60-70% success rate)
  • Popular banking jurisdictions: Cyprus, Latvia, Georgia, Mauritius, Singapore
  • Account opening timeline: 3-6 weeks with complete documentation
  • Minimum deposit requirements: $2,000 - $10,000 typically
  • Strong acceptance by EMI providers (Wise, Payoneer, Revolut)

Panama Banking Relationships

  • Strong local banking sector with multiple options
  • Good international bank acceptance (80-85% success rate)
  • Popular options: Local Panamanian banks, US correspondent banks, international banks
  • Account opening timeline: 2-4 weeks (faster with in-person visit)
  • Minimum deposit requirements: $5,000 - $15,000 typically
  • USD official currency alongside Balboa eliminates exchange risk

Banking Verdict: Panama offers significantly superior banking access with higher success rates, more local banking options, and better acceptance by international financial institutions.

Privacy and Confidentiality Features

Seychelles Privacy Protections

  • No public register of directors or shareholders
  • Beneficial ownership private (disclosed only to registered agent)
  • Bearer shares allowed but must be immobilized with authorized custodian
  • Nominee services fully legal and widely available
  • No public financial statement filing requirement
  • Strong bank confidentiality laws
  • CRS and FATCA compliant

Panama Privacy Protections

  • Corporation registered publicly but ownership details remain private
  • Beneficial ownership information held by resident agent
  • Bearer shares fully allowed and commonly used for maximum privacy
  • Nominee services available (though less necessary with bearer shares)
  • Financial statements required but not filed publicly
  • Very strong banking privacy laws
  • CRS and FATCA compliant

Privacy Verdict: Both jurisdictions offer excellent privacy. Panama's unrestricted bearer shares provide maximum anonymity without additional custodian requirements, offering slight advantage for privacy-focused businesses.

Seychelles IBC Act 2016

  • Company type: International Business Company (IBC)
  • Legal system: English Common Law
  • Minimum directors: 1 (individual or corporate, any nationality)
  • Minimum shareholders: 1
  • No minimum share capital requirement
  • Annual meetings not required
  • Accounting records must be maintained but not filed

Panama Law No. 32 of 1927

  • Company type: Private Interest Foundation or Corporation
  • Legal system: Civil law with strong corporate framework
  • Minimum directors: 3 (individuals or corporate, any nationality)
  • Share capital: No minimum (typically $10,000 authorized)
  • Annual meetings required (can be held anywhere)
  • Resident agent required (must be Panamanian lawyer)
  • Accounting records must be maintained for 5 years

Compliance and Substance Requirements

Seychelles Compliance

  • Economic substance requirements apply for certain activities
  • Relevant activities: Banking, insurance, fund management, financing, leasing, IP, distribution
  • Pure holding companies have reduced requirements
  • Annual economic substance declaration required
  • Non-compliance penalties: $5,000 - $50,000

Panama Compliance

  • No formal economic substance regime
  • Annual franchise tax and declaration required
  • Resident agent must be maintained at all times
  • Financial records kept for 5 years (not filed publicly)
  • AML/KYC due diligence conducted by resident agents

Conclusion

Both Seychelles and Panama provide excellent value as budget-friendly offshore jurisdictions with legitimate corporate structures, strong privacy protections, and zero taxation benefits.

Seychelles emerges as the most cost-effective option with $995 formation, $750 annual fees, and fastest processing at 1-2 days. This makes it ideal for e-commerce, digital businesses, and entrepreneurs prioritizing cost savings and speed.

Panama justifies its premium of $300 formation and $200 annual fees through superior banking access (80-85% success rate), unrestricted bearer shares, and stronger local banking infrastructure. This makes it worth the investment for businesses requiring traditional banking relationships and maximum privacy.
